Wān Sa-sūmpū
Wān Sa-sūmpū is a locality in Mong Yawng Townshipe, Tachileik District, Shan State and has an elevation of 2,805 feet. Wān Sa-sūmpū is situated nearby to the locality Wān Sa-āt, as well as near Wān Sa-hkön.| Tap on a place to explore it |
